About the role

As an Optical Assistant you will be a fundamental part of our Boots Opticians store team, being the first and last person that our customers interact with.

You will be based in store and report to the store manager. You will work on the shop floor and spend your time building great relationships with customers by listening and understanding their needs to find the right product or service for them. From greeting customers when they arrive in store, being part of the pre-screening activities of an eye-test through to helping our customers find the perfect eye-wear solution for them – no two days will be the same.

Your role within the team as an Optical Assistant will give you lots of opportunities to develop your knowledge through our industry-leading ‘Step Into Optics’ training programme. This programme includes both workshop-based learning and practical ‘on the job’ experience. You will also:
  • Order, dispense and collect glasses and contact lenses
  • Support with eye-tests and pre-screening activities
  • Provide aftercare support through repairs and adjustments
  • Complete operational and administrative tasks associated with dispensing prescriptions
  • Maintain shop floor standards
